Distinct genetic pathways define pre-leukemic and compensatory clonal hematopoiesis in Shwachman-Diamond syndrome
2020-06-05
Abstract excerpt
Shwachman-Diamond syndrome (SDS) is an inherited bone marrow failure syndrome with predisposition to developing leukemia. We found that multiple independent somatic hematopoietic clones arise early in life, most commonly harboring heterozygous mutations in EIF6 or TP53 .
